Fundamentals of Motion: How a Drone Motor Works

Before beginning any construction, it is crucial for junior students to understand the internal mechanics of a drone motor. Many current devices present in a hobby drone motor kit are permanent magnet designs. Differing from old-fashioned engines, these use a sequence of magnets and electromagnets to produce spinning with minimal resistance. This renders them extremely speedy, which is why precaution is always the top priority in any drone motor activity.

Instructing children about the relationship of magnetic forces is a perfect way to present physics. Inside the housing of the drone motor, electrical pulses make the middle rotor to follow an rotating invisible force. If a student wires the components from a drone motor kit, the youngsters are literally setting up a small electrical system that converts battery potential into rapid action.

Essential Precautions for Kids Tech Projects

Safety must never be ignored while playing with a drone motor. Since these engines are able to reach thousands of RPM, the spinning parts can be hazardous if touched while active. Teacher oversight is essential during every phase of the tech project. Before opening a drone motor kit, make sure that the blades are not fixed until the very end step of the calibration process.

An additional important safety advice is to consistently wear eye protection. Tiny parts might fly if a robot shatters due to the force of the drone motor. By teaching these proper habits early, educators will be readying young scientists for a long future in innovation. Ensure to verify the connections in your drone motor kit for any damage prior to connecting battery energy.

Building a Scribble Robot Using Drone Parts

The highly beloved initial tasks for children is the Art Robot. This utilizes the high-speed power of a drone motor to create colorful patterns. Rather of relying on the motor for flight, you fix it to the frame of a disposable container with an off-center mass glued to the axle. When the drone motor spins, it creates the whole robot to vibrate rapidly.

By taping crayons to the base of the chassis, the robot can skitter across a giant sheet of paper, leaving swirling designs in its wake. A drone motor kit typically provides the necessary wires and battery holders to make this build easy for starters. This activity teaches concepts of rotational force and mechanical motion in a very engaging manner.

Project Idea 2: The High-Speed Propeller Boat

Should your child enjoys aquatic projects, building a motorized craft is a fantastic option. Using a buoyant material like as Styrofoam or a recycled container, one will secure a drone motor to the stern to act as a fast propeller. This project is a smart method to reuse parts from a drone motor kit which might else be unused.

This pushing force created by the drone motor can launch the craft through the surface at surprising velocities. It's important to remind children that water and batteries do not work well together well. Make sure that the drone motor kit wires are positioned above the surface or inside a protected case. The experiment aids in explaining Newton's Third Principle of Motion: to each action, there is an equal and opposite force.

What to Look for When Buying Tech Components for Kids

Not every motors are created the same. When looking for a drone motor kit, it is essential to search for suitable specifications for child-friendly builds. Many kits will carry ratings like RPM per volt ratings and size measurements. In simple ground-based activities, a lower KV drone motor is frequently better to control and run using basic cells.

A superb drone motor kit must also arrive with Electronic Speed Units (ESCs). Those parts serve as the middleman of the battery and the drone motor, permitting the users to vary the speed effectively. Teaching learners how to wire those blocks builds technical reasoning and fine hand skills.

Advanced Concepts: Reversing Direction and Speed Control

When the fundamentals are understood, kids can investigate the ways to control the drone motor with greater precision. By employing an Arduino or a basic tester found in a drone motor kit, they can learn to flip the spin of movement. This typically means switching any of the wires linking the motor to the ESC.

Understanding digital signal modulation (PWM) is the following logical stage. It is the protocol which commands the drone motor how quickly to rotate. Although this sounds difficult, most drone motor kit resources offer visual help to keep it approachable for younger learners. Achieving this gives students a significant early start in modern robotics.

Building a Motorized Fan: A Practical Home Application

A third useful application is creating a high-powered desk fan. An spare drone motor is excellent for such a purpose because the motor stays small yet displaces a large volume of wind. Children will construct a base out of cardboard and mount the motor from their drone motor kit tightly to the top.

The build emphasizes the necessity of balance. If the fan blade is not perfectly centered on the drone motor, the fan will wobble or fall down. Discovering to tune moving assemblies proves to be an priceless lesson in mechanics. Additionally, the result is a functional device which they will personally use in their bedroom.
